Book excerpt: Marine Gyro-Compasses and Automatic Pilots: A Handbook for Merchant Navy Officers, Volume One: Gyro Compasses is manual for the various types of compass utilized in naval navigation. The text details the apparent motion of fixed objects, and then proceeds to discussing the principles of free gyroscopes. Next, the selection tackles controlled gyroscopes and gyroscopic compasses. The text also covers errors and corrections, along with the comparison of gyroscopic and magnetic compasses. The subsequent chapters talk about the different types of gyro compasses, such as Sperry Gyro-Compass Mark E. XIV, The Brown Gyro-Compass Types A and B, Arma-Brown Compass, and The Marine Gyrosyn Compass. The book will be of great use to student and professional maritime navigators.

Book excerpt: Excerpt from The Gyroscopic Compass: A Non-Mathematical Treatment The chapters composing this book originally appeared as a series of articles in The Engineer during January, February, and March of the current year. The articles were written in the belief that many readers would welcome a clear and full, non-mathematical exposition of the gyroscopic compass, its theory and practical construction. The gyro-compass represents at once the most involved and abstruse and the most important and valuable of all the practical applications to which the gyroscope, so far, has been put. As a navigational instrument it is now in practically universal use in all the chief war navies of the world, and is to-day being adopted by several important representatives of the mercantile marine. Remarkable figures were shown to the author recently which demonstrated that not only was navigation by the gyro-compass much more accurate than by the magnetic compass, but that the increased accuracy reduced the length of the voyage of a mercantile vessel to an extent that resulted in saving a quantity of fuel the value of which on a single trip would go a considerable way towards meeting the extra first cost of the gyrocompass.
